miniNAS/docker_compose/syncthing.yml

31 lines
621 B
YAML

version: "3"
services:
syncthing:
image: syncthing/syncthing
container_name: syncthing
hostname: mininas
volumes:
- $SYNCTHING_DIR:/var/syncthing
expose:
- 8384
- 22000/tcp
- 22000/udp
environment:
- PUID=33
- PGID=33
# - PUID=1000
# - PGID=1000
- VIRTUAL_HOST=files.$LETSENCRYPT_DOMAIN
- VIRTUAL_PORT=8384
- LETSENCRYPT_HOST=files.$LETSENCRYPT_DOMAIN
- LETSENCRYPT_EMAIL=$LETSENCRYPT_EMAIL
restart: unless-stopped
networks:
- default
networks:
default:
external:
name: $SERVER_DOCKER_NETWORKNAME